A Volvo vac valve has 4 electrical terminals. An old DAF one 3.

 

Make sure you have an earth going to each side as each solenoid is independently earthed.

 

Doesn't matter if the diode is there or not on a DAF. Important for a later car with a tacho relay to avoid reverse emf spike.

I thought I'd keep y'all posted with my learnings from other sources. This is from a convo with Volvo 300 Mac as suggested by Eddie Honda: 

 

The vacuum drawn in the primary pulley's outer chambers (assisting "change up") is indeed considerably less than the maximum depression obtained by the engine. 

 

As engine vacuum varies depending on road & engine speed, throttle position and brake activation if this were applied directly to the primary unit the result would be constantly changing vacuum assistance to the speed determined centrifugal gear changing. 

Hence the "overdrive" vacuum is regulated to 45kPa (negative). Engine vacuum can go as high 

as 70kPa (neg.) at idle but much higher under deceleration with a closed throttle.

 

A second potential problem with allowing unregulated vacuum to be drawn in the outer chambers could be a reluctance for the transmission to "change down" - remaining in "O/D" even at very low speed (try pulling away again in 4th or 5th gear in a manual box).

 

No physical damage would be caused to diaphragms by greater depression (in fact the "brake" side of the same diaphragms are subjected to this under normal operation.

Some small benefit can be gained by increasing the depression on the O/D side and in fact the vac valve on Volvo 340 models after 1979 were regulated to 50kKPa (negative).

 

If your "Change up" is not performing as you feel it should I would suggest (sorry if I'm telling you what you already know) checking for vac leaks (primary pulley cover pipe seals are a good place to start).

I reckon a Hardi Fuel Pump is a better proposition than a Facet. Will self prime and only pumps when the pressure drops. Also gives a satisfying clicking noise when it's working all fine. If you get loads of clicking, you know you're pumping air and probably going to cut out shortly!
